body{background-color:#eee;color:#000;font-family:Arial-MT-Light,sans-serif}.Arial-MT-Medium{font-family:"Arial-MT-Medium",sans-serif}.Arial-MT-Light{font-family:"Arial-MT-Light",sans-serif}h1{color:#000;font-family:Arial-MT-Medium,sans-serif}h2{color:#3ecc58;font-family:Arial-MT-Light,sans-serif}h3{color:#000;font-family:Arial-MT-Medium,sans-serif}h4{color:#3ecc58;font-family:Arial-MT-Light,sans-serif}h5{color:#000;font-family:Arial-MT-Medium,sans-serif}h6{color:#000;font-family:Arial-MT-Medium,sans-serif}a{color:#000;text-decoration:none}a:hover{color:#3ecc58}.text-site{color:#3ecc58 !important}.rounded-5{border-radius:.6rem !important}.rounded-top-5{border-radius:.6rem .6rem 0 0 !important}#legal_representative [type=radio]{position:absolute;opacity:0;width:0;height:0}#legal_representative [type=radio]+img{cursor:pointer}#legal_representative [type=radio]:checked+img{outline:2px solid #42b4e6;border-radius:50%}.nbcollaborateurs [type=radio]{border-radius:unset;width:1.5em;height:1.5em}.border-bottom{box-shadow:0 8px 6px -6px dimgrey}.border-bottom h3{font-size:2rem;color:#3ecc58}.progress-bar{background-image:none;background-color:#3ecc58;transition:width 2.5s ease}.border-blue{padding:1.5rem;border:1px solid #3ecc58;border-radius:25px;min-height:10rem}.number{font-size:3rem;color:#000}.background-footer{background:0;background-color:#333}.background-green{background:0;background-color:#3ecc58}.card.card-etape{-webkit-border-radius:0;-moz-border-radius:0;border-radius:0;background-color:#e6e6e6}.card.card-etape h1{color:#000;margin-left:80px}.card.card-etape .card-footer{background-color:#e6e6e6;border:0}.header{background-color:#fff;color:#fff;font-size:1.5rem}.header p{font-size:1rem}.header h2{color:#fff}.footer{background-color:#fff;font-size:.7rem}.border-top-blue{border-top:5px solid #3ecc58}.bg-grey{background-color:#f6f6f6}#inscription{min-height:300px}.header-produits h1{font-size:3rem}.background-red{background:0;background-color:#3ecc58}.background-grey{background:0;background-color:#625555}.progress .progress-bar .bg-light-blue{color:#3ecc58 !important}.progress .progress-bar .bg-light-grey{color:#f6f6f6 !important}.btn-red{background-image:none;background-color:#3ecc58;color:#fff !important;text-shadow:none;border:1px solid #3ecc58}.btn-red:hover{background-color:#fff;color:#3ecc58 !important}.btn-outline-red{background-image:none;background-color:#fff;color:#3ecc58 !important;text-shadow:none;border:1px solid #3ecc58}.btn-outline-red:hover{background-color:#3ecc58;color:#fff !important;border:1px solid #fff}.btn-outline-grey{background-image:none;background-color:#fff;color:#625555 !important;text-shadow:none;border:1px solid #625555}.btn-outline-grey:hover{background-color:#625555;color:#fff !important;border:1px solid #fff}.btn{font-family:Futura-PT-Medium,sans-serif;-webkit-border-radius:unset;-moz-border-radius:unset;border-radius:unset}.btn-site{color:white;background-color:#3ecc58}.btn-site:hover{border:1px solid #3ecc58;color:#3ecc58;background-color:#fff}.btn-outline-site{border:1px solid #3ecc58;color:#3ecc58;background-color:#fff}.btn-outline-site:hover{color:white;background-color:#3ecc58}.btn-select{font-family:Futura-PT-Heavy,serif}.btn-outline-blue{background-color:#fff;color:#3ecc58 !important;border:1px solid #3ecc58}.btn-outline-blue:hover{background-image:none;background-color:#3ecc58;color:#fff !important;text-shadow:none;border:1px solid #3ecc58}.btn-grey{background-image:none;background-color:#fff !important;color:#625555 !important;text-shadow:none;border:1px solid #625555 !important}.btn-grey:hover{background-color:#625555 !important;color:#fff !important}#logo_droite{display:block}.text-red{color:#ff243a}.text-orange{color:#efa741}.text-bleu{color:#83c7c3}.progress{height:.5rem !important;border-radius:unset !important}.input-obligatory{color:#3ecc58}.hr-orange{width:70px;height:5px !important;background-color:#efa741;opacity:1}.hr-bleu{width:70px;height:5px !important;background-color:#83c7c3;opacity:1}.hr-rose{width:70px;height:5px !important;background-color:#cf63cd;opacity:1}.breadcrumb-item{font-weight:bold;font-size:.8rem}.breadcrumb-item a{color:#000}.breadcrumb-item.active{color:#3ecc58}.etapes{color:#919491}.etapes .actif{color:#3ecc58}.error{color:#dd4b39;display:inline}.border-dotted{border:3px dashed #3ecc58}.blue-color{background-color:#3ecc58}.blue{color:#3ecc58}.fs-7{font-size:.9rem}.fs-6{font-size:.7rem !important}.no-border{border-radius:unset;border:1px solid #fff}.files{border:1px solid #3ecc58}.form-group label{font-family:Futura-PT-Heavy,sans-serif}.form-group .form-check-label{font-family:Futura-PT-Book,sans-serif}.form-group input:hover,.form-group select:hover,.form-group textarea:hover,.form-group input:focus,.form-group select:focus,.form-group textarea:focus{background-color:#eff}.upload-group{min-height:10rem}.upload-group>input{display:none}.form-group .form-select,.form-group .form-control{-webkit-border-radius:unset;-moz-border-radius:unset;border-radius:unset}@media(max-width:992px){.bloc-header img{display:none}.bloc-header .position-absolute{position:relative !important;width:100% !important}}@media(max-width:420px){#logo_droite{display:none}}